Ms06934 Lake Dam, located in Carroll, Mississippi, is a privately owned structure regulated by the Mississippi Department of Environmental Quality.
Wind
Humidity
With a primary purpose of recreation, this earth dam stands at a height of 25 feet and offers a storage capacity of 102 acre-feet. The dam features an uncontrolled spillway and is classified as having a low hazard potential, with a moderate overall risk assessment.
